Wizards veteran Miles has wrist surgery

Washington Wizards guard C.J. Miles had surgery Wednesday to repair ligament damage in his left wrist. There is no timetable for the return of the 32-year-old veteran, who was injured during a Nov. 26 loss in Denver.

Miles is averaging 6.4 points and 1.2 rebounds in 10 games in his first season with the Wizards. In 848 career games (303 starts), he has averaged 9.6 points and 2.4 rebounds with the Utah Jazz (2005-12), Cleveland Cavaliers (2012-14), Indiana Pacers (2014-17), Toronto Raptors (2017-19), Memphis Grizzlies (2019) and Wizards. He ranks 56th all-time with 1,250 made 3-pointers.

The Grizzlies traded him to the Wizards on July 6 for center Dwight Howard.
